Rules Don't Apply (2016)
The unconventional love story of an aspiring actress, her ambitious driver, and their eccentric boss, the legendary billionaire Howard Hughes.

Rules Don’t Apply is one of those rare modern films that feels like it was poured out of old Hollywood’s golden cocktail shaker—glossy, funny, faintly melancholy, and just odd enough to be irresistible. Warren Beatty stages 1958 Los Angeles with loving craftsmanship and a satirist’s eye, then drops Lily Collins and Alden Ehrenreich into it as two sincere young people trying to stay decent while the town (and their employer, an intriguingly off-kilter Howard Hughes) keeps moving the goalposts. The pleasure is in the tone: romantic sparks and screwball rhythms brushing up against real longing and the unsettling gravity of power, all carried by performances that keep the characters human rather than symbolic. It’s not for everyone—its shaggy, throwback pacing and eccentric detours can feel like a studio-era epic wandering through a modern runtime—but if you enjoy movies that luxuriate in period vibe while gently skewering American hypocrisy, it’s an easy one to recommend.
Rules Don’t Apply is clearly trying to be a glossy, old-Hollywood romantic dramedy that also peeks behind the curtain at Howard Hughes’ eccentric orbit, and you can feel Warren Beatty’s affection for that era in the costumes, cars, and showbiz texture. The problem is it never quite decides whether it’s a sweeping romance, a satirical Hollywood postcard, or a character study of Hughes, so the pacing drifts and the story keeps changing lanes without landing a satisfying emotional punch. Lily Collins and Alden Ehrenreich are likable, but the romance can feel strangely stiff and undercooked, which makes the whole “forbidden love” hook less swoony than it wants to be. If you’re expecting a sharp comedy, a steamy romance, or a focused Hughes biopic, this may test your patience; if you’re happy to coast on period charm and oddball moments, there’s enough here to mildly enjoy.
